Output 660624cf2b5e93d9aa1f53f7717d7aa4be0cfa81ec73aa421bade48393223471:0

value
6168684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2ad7ff0e5f60de4161a18bdb15674de8e82b1d3 OP_EQUALVERIFY OP_CHECKSIG
address
1MfZZL5mH9ev2A8C5R7BmofcnhymahzswU
transaction
660624cf2b5e93d9aa1f53f7717d7aa4be0cfa81ec73aa421bade48393223471
spent
true